| Manufactured: | 1877 to 1942 |
| Length: | 10-1/2 inches |
| Blade Width: | 3/16 inches |
| Construction: | Cast iron, rosewood knob |
| Finish: | Nickel plated |
| Features: | Swinging fence |
| Uses: | Cuts a tongue & groove joint for joining boards |
| Average Dealer Price: | $75 to $175 |
| Average eBay Price: | $60 to $160 |
| Type 1: | $100 to $250 |
| Other Notes: | Identical to the No. 48 except for cutter size. Earlier types were japanned prior to 1898 |

| Sources: | While many of the dealers prices for Stanley planes are largely set by John Walters’ book “Antique & Collectible Stanley Tools” it appears that eBay, while acknowledging the Walters guide somewhat, tends to march to it’s own beat and sets its own prices. For that reason - and the fact that eBay’s reach and customer base is huge - I’ve decided to include a separate eBay average price here. Other sources include: “The Antique Tool Collector’s Guide To Value” by Ronald S. Barlow, “Antique & Collectible Stanley Tools” by John Walter, “The Stanley Plane” by Alvin Sellens, “Patrick’s Blood & Gore” by Patrick Leach, various auctions and sales of collectable tools and my own compilations of prices realized, observations and notes over the past 20+ years. |
